在当今数字化时代,服务器框架搭建对于各类应用的高效运行起着至关重要的作用。服务类框架作为其中的关键部分,承载着众多服务的部署与交互。它犹如一座坚实的桥梁,连接着不同的功能模块,确保数据能够准确、快速地在各个环节之间流通。

服务类框架具备高度的灵活性与扩展性。它可以根据不同的业务需求进行定制化配置,无论是小型的企业级应用还是大型的互联网平台,都能找到适配的框架方案。通过合理的架构设计,服务类框架能够有效提升系统的性能,减少响应时间,为用户提供更加流畅的体验。
在构建服务类框架时,首先要考虑的是其底层架构的稳定性。采用成熟的技术栈和设计模式,能够确保框架在面对高并发、大数据量等复杂场景时依然保持可靠运行。良好的分层架构也是必不可少的,它将业务逻辑、数据访问、表示层等进行清晰划分,使得各个部分职责明确,便于维护和升级。
服务类框架还需要具备强大的通信能力。支持多种协议的交互,如HTTP、TCP等,能够与不同的客户端和其他服务进行无缝对接。这不仅方便了与外部系统的集成,还为业务的拓展提供了广阔的空间。例如,通过HTTP协议可以轻松实现与前端应用的交互,将后端服务的数据实时展示给用户。
服务类框架的安全性也是不容忽视的重要因素。在网络环境日益复杂的今天,保护数据的安全和隐私是至关重要的。框架应具备完善的认证机制、加密算法等,防止数据泄露和恶意攻击。对于敏感信息的传输和存储,要进行严格的加密处理,确保只有授权的用户能够访问。
服务类框架的可维护性也是衡量其优劣的关键指标。易于理解和修改的代码结构,以及完善的日志记录和监控系统,能够帮助开发人员快速定位和解决问题。通过日志,我们可以详细了解系统的运行状态,及时发现潜在的风险和异常情况。监控系统则可以实时监测服务器的各项性能指标,如CPU使用率、内存占用等,以便及时进行调整和优化。
随着云计算、微服务等技术的不断发展,服务类框架也在不断演进。微服务架构下的服务类框架更加注重各个服务的独立性和自治性,通过轻量级的通信机制实现服务之间的协同工作。这种架构使得系统能够更加灵活地应对业务变化,快速迭代新的功能。
云计算为服务类框架提供了强大的资源支持。借助云平台的弹性计算能力,我们可以根据实际业务需求动态调整服务器资源,避免资源浪费和性能瓶颈。云服务提供商还提供了一系列的管理工具和服务,帮助我们更便捷地部署和管理服务类框架。
服务器框架搭建中的服务类框架是一个综合性的关键组件。它的稳定性、灵活性、扩展性、通信能力、安全性以及可维护性等方面都直接影响着整个系统的运行效果。在不断发展的技术浪潮中,我们需要紧跟时代步伐,持续优化和完善服务类框架,以满足日益增长的业务需求,为数字化世界的高效运转提供坚实保障。只有这样,我们才能在激烈的市场竞争中占据优势,实现业务的持续发展和创新。








